About the Role

We're looking for a creative and results-driven Digital Marketing Executive to join our growing team. You will help deliver engaging digital experiences that connect with customers, strengthen brand awareness, and support business growth. Working across multiple digital channels, you'll use customer insights and performance data to optimise campaigns, enhance engagement, and drive continuous improvement in our digital marketing activity.

You will be responsible for

  • Plan and execute the digital content strategy in line with our comms plan for customer and franchise and ensure the correct channels are used to meet audience needs.
  • Manage end-to-end email campaigns, including planning, coordinating, set-up, segmenting, targeting, testing, reporting and optimisation.
  • Develop and maintain the email marketing test plans, launch tests, analyse and report test results.
  • Track and analyse all email performance and provide recommendations based on customer trends and behaviour in conjunction with our target audiences.
  • Implement and contribute to the strategy for the One Stop and Franchise website, working to enhance the user experience, ensuring our content is optimised, accurate, compelling for the audience and on-brand.
  • Implement day-to-day updates of our content management system (CMS) including promotional, seasonal, ad hoc & inspirational campaigns and updates.
  • Plan and execute engaging and relevant customer campaigns on digital platforms including gamification, analysing findings and using results for future campaigns and growth.
  • Use CRM to maximise digital marketing opportunities.
  • Execute Mobile and Digital display ad campaigns & provide recommendations for best performing ROI.
  • Responsible for our SEO for both Franchise and Core ensuring that its regularly updated through SEO tracking programs.
  • Ensure that the data transfer process, data hygiene, GDPR opt-out compliance and contact management is effective, compliant & optimise.
  • Provide reports to the business on a regular basis.
  • Work closely with in-house teams to create compelling concepts and creative.
  • Manage internal & external stakeholders building strong relationships with key Tesco colleagues, & the in-house creative team.
  • Keep abreast of digital platforms and innovation to ensure that the brand maintains competitive advantage.
  • Work alongside digital team members to ensure that our digital content is consistent, up to date and on-brand.
  • Work closely with and report to the Digital Marketing Manager to ensure our digital channels are playing their role in the customer journey.

You will need

  • Marketing degree, CIM or similar qualification.
  • Ideally a commercial / FMCG, e communication marketing background.
  • Analytical, with data-lead approach.
  • Good analysis / numerical skills.
  • Good time management, planning and organisation skills.
  • Knowledge of the convenience retail sector.
  • Experience with email, SEO, PPC, product catalogue and CMS systems.
  • Experience in building strong relationships and managing stakeholders.

Community Involvement

At One Stop, being part of the community is at the heart of everything we do. From supporting local charities and groups to partnering with national organisations, we’re proud to give back in meaningful ways.

Over the past decade, we’ve raised over £10.4 million for good causes and donated the equivalent of 1.6 million meals through our partnerships with FareShare and Olio, helping to reduce food waste and support those in need.
